Output fc93528ec6c06a3ea5be9a2284d9f3df51fafe73d6a60aaeba5329dde54b517d:14

value
1687494
script pubkey
OP_0 OP_PUSHBYTES_20 c37950fc988e466577bf861475ee62a993f96b00
address
bc1qcdu4plyc3erx2aalsc28tmnz4xflj6cqmpp07h
transaction
fc93528ec6c06a3ea5be9a2284d9f3df51fafe73d6a60aaeba5329dde54b517d
confirmations
289344
spent
true